Publisher's summary

This is a surreal short story about a man named Withers. Withers leads a very predictable life until one very peculiar day. He then finds out that reality is not what he has always perceived it to be.

Suspenseful and Entertaining

Where does A Human Living in Cyberspace rank among all the audiobooks you’ve listened to so far?

A Human Living in Cyberspace is probably one of the best fictional audiobooks I have ever listened to. The story is suspenseful and the narration captured the emotions of the character splendidly. The sound effects were also perfectly placed.

What was one of the most memorable moments of A Human Living in Cyberspace?

I can't go into detail because I would spoil it for the rest of you, but the most memorable moment was the moment when everything changed for the main character; that was intense.

What about John Alan Martinson Jr.’s performance did you like?

I really enjoyed how John was able to convey the emotions of the character and the nature of the situation with his reading.
